The Hidden Triggers Beyond the Burp

Most people think heartburn stems solely from excess stomach acid, but that’s a simplification.

The real culprit often lies deeper—in dysmotility, delayed gastric emptying, and even stress-induced vagal overactivity. Chronic stress, for instance, disrupts gastric acid secretion patterns, creating cycles where acid spikes peak at suboptimal times. Similarly, low-grade inflammation in the esophageal lining weakens its protective barrier, making even mild acid exposure damaging. Research from the *Journal of Gastrointestinal Physiology* (2023) confirms that up to 40% of reported heartburn cases involve non-acidic reflux, challenging the one-size-fits-all proton-pump inhibitor model.

Lifestyle as Pharmacology

Posture and timing matter. Elevating the head of the bed by just 6 inches—about 15 cm—reduces nocturnal acid exposure by nearly half, a low-cost intervention validated by sleep medicine experts. Equally pivotal: avoiding lying down within three hours of eating. A 2024 cohort study in *Alimentary Pharmacology & Therapeutics* revealed that this simple delay cut reflux episodes by 52% in high-risk individuals. Even breathing patterns shift the balance—diaphragmatic breathing, practiced for 10 minutes daily, activates the vagus nerve to strengthen sphincter tone, offering a non-pharmacologic intervention as effective as first-line antacids in mild cases.

Herbal remedies, too, demand scrutiny. Licorice root, specifically deglycyrrhizinated forms (DGL), has demonstrated efficacy in clinical trials: DGL chews 30 minutes before meals reduce symptom severity by 60% in 12 weeks, without the hormonal side effects of synthetic glycerrhizin.

Yet, caution is warranted—chamomile, while soothing, contains apigenin, which may mildly relax the sphincter in some, underscoring the need for personalized approaches.

When to Seek Beyond the Pill

For most, gentle remedies suffice—but persistent symptoms signal deeper dysfunction. Chronic heartburn correlates with Barrett’s esophagus in 0.5–1% of cases, a precancerous condition requiring endoscopic surveillance. Moreover, overreliance on acid suppressors increases fracture risk and gut dysbiosis, as shown in a landmark *BMJ* study tracking 100,000 users. Gentle relief, by contrast, fosters resilience without compromising microbiome diversity or long-term safety.
